The Inventors Association of Arizona is a nonprofit, tax-exempt charitable organization under Section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code and is a registered Non-Profit Organization in Arizona. Donations and Memberships are tax-deductible as allowed by law.

training & Networking
1st Wednesday of the month | 6 – 8 PM
Join us on the 1st Wed. of the month for our VIRTUAL meetings featuring expert guest speakers and Q&A round tables to learn about how to invent and bring new products to market. think tank
3rd Wednesday of the month | 6 – 8 PM
Membership with the IAA entitles you to join us for our VIRTUAL Think Tank meetings where attendees have the opportunity to share in a CONFIDENTIAL forum, get feedback, support, and network with one another.
